Edinburgh Accies 8 - 30 Gala: Gala bounce back

GALA produced an impressive display to bounce back from last week’s defeat and maintain their title challenge when they took all five points against their fellow British & Irish Cup representatives.

The Borderers dominated the early proceedings but the combination of a dogged home defence and lack of composure near the line left the scoreline blank until the 19th minute, when Andy McLean darted through a gap for a well-taken try.

McLean turned creator five minutes later to send Steve Cairns in at the corner and Euan Scott added the extras then banged over a penalty for a 15 point lead.

Accies had barely ventured into opposition territory, and the task they faced became greater when the referee showed Stuart Evans a yellow card. Gala took full advantage, booting a penalty into touch then driving over the line, where Tom Weir touched down.

Accies had the final word in the first half when Sam Pecqueur raced in and Alex Blair, above, landed a penalty that sparked a brief spell of pressure for the hosts.

Gala added a penalty from Scott then clinched the bonus point with a Liam Draycott try, Scott adding the conversion.
